Matt is spot-on for the Crows

By Duncan Easley
ROYSTON TOWN 1
BANBURY UNITED 0
AN 88TH-MINUTE penalty from Matt Bateman deservedly gave Royston victory, as they overcame a Banbury side who were so close to getting the draw they set out to achieve.
Banbury’s intentions were clear from the off, as within the first ten minutes the away goalkeeper, Jack Harding, was penalised for time wasting. Unfortunately for Royston, the resulting free-kick was blazed wildly over by Luke Warner-Eley.
